Supply Chapter Over. IRT firmly believes that the industry is turning the page on the supply wave and

is seeing concrete evidence as occupancies are approaching 88-89% across its markets (historically

92-93%). Roughly 40% of submarkets have seen market occupancies climb above 90%. IRT estimates

2026 supply at +2.6% followed by +1.2% in 2027 and +1.3% in 2028. Barring healthy demand, this

tailwind could translate into long-term CAGR on par with pre-COVID averages between +5-6%.

Value-Add Potential. IRT has pursued 2,000-2,500 value-add units annually over the past few years

with rent premiums of +15%. However, under normalizing supply conditions, IRT has historically seen

premiums between +20-30% with renewal rates running at +6% compared to 1Q26 value-add same store

of +3.2%. IRT noted that it is able to push its value-add program towards 3,000 units annually without

straining resources or putting pressure on operations.

Reshoring Opportunity. IRT continues to see strength across select markets with nearby anchoring chip

manufacturing such as Columbus, OH and Dallas, TX with key companies including Anduril, Intel, and

Texas Instruments.

Wi-Fi Bonus. IRT is currently rolling out its wi-fi program which will boost 2026 revenue and NOI by $6M

and $3M, respectively. For 2027, these figures are estimated at $12M and $6M, respectively.

Insurance Update. IRT completed its insurance renewal on May 15th with premiums down -24.5%

compared to initial guidance of -20%.
